Despite some new competition, Suicide Squad remains at the top of the domestic weekend box office.

This past weekend, the super villain team-up movie added $20.7 million in North America for a domestic box office of $262.3 million. That is an over 50% audience drop from the previous weekend. The domestic movie gross is currently ahead of what Guardians of the Galaxy made in the same timeframe of their theatrical run in 2014.

On the international side, Suicide Squad made an additional $38 million this weekend for a foreign total of $310.4 million. Those numbers combined with the domestic gross gives Suicide Squad a total worldwide gross of $572.7 million.

The good news for fans is that the film still has some untapped markets. It will be opening in Japan on  September 5. Earlier this year, Batman v Superman opened in Japan to $3 million and went on to make $16.5 million there. If Suicide Squad has a similar gross as Batman v Superman in the Japanese market, we can be soon looking at the film surpassing the $600 million worldwide box office milestone in the immediate future.
